- [ ] **Step 7: Breaker override escrow.** After sealing the signing keys for the Tallgrove upstream API circuit breaker, confirm the support team can force the breaker open during a full outage. The override bundle lives in the sealed escrow drawer and is useless without its unlock phrase. Two ceremony witnesses must initial this step before proceeding. The escrow bundle is decrypted with the recovery passphrase that follows.

vault phrase of kahip-kahop = holath-quenmir

CI note: Emberline firmware channel flakiness

If the device-firmware update channel on Emberline CI starts failing with checksum mismatches, it's almost always a stale artifact cache on the flasher runner, not a real corruption. Clear the runner cache and re-trigger the publish stage before panicking. Don't repin the toolchain; that made things worse last time. The last known-good build is noted below.

build token for kagaf-hahof: htk14_9d3d4d26d7d8de

### Step 4: Enable the tile cache

Plugin authors deploying against Mapwick's tile-rendering cache must set the cache region explicitly; auto-detection is disabled for third-party builds. Verify the region matches your render cluster, then restart the warmer once. Before the warmer can authenticate to the cache layer, add the credential line directly beneath this point in your env file.

secret setting of yajog-taguf: ARCHIVE_KEY3=051